The NEMO basic support protocol is extension of Mobile IP, to support group mobility. It can support network mobility in IEEE 802.16e networks. But it causes negative effect on handover latency performance which is not negligible for real-time applications. In this paper, an integrated scheme that combines cross layer design and cross function optimization to improve the handover latency is proposed. In the Optimized Fast NEMO (OFNEMO) the relative messages of both, L2 handover in IEEE802.16e and L3 handover in fast mobile IPv6 and the NEMO basic support are merged. Also a pre-established tunnels concept is used to reduce service disruption time. Analytical results show that the OFNEMO can reduce handover latency (91% in predict mode, 89% in semi-predictive mode and 4% in reactive mode), reduce packet losses and increase probability of predictive mode.
